Overview

Located in the heart of a downtown district, Mccall House Boutique Hotel Ashland is at a distance of 4.9 km from Oak Knoll Golf Course, which is a great spot for sports fans to visit. A car park is provided on site.

Location

The hotel is about a 25-minute walk from the Southern Oregon Schneider University Museum of Art, quite close to Lithia Park. This 5-star hotel is at a distance of 450 metres from Ashland Food Co-op and 30 km from Rogue Valley International-Medford airport. Oregon Shakespeare Festival lies right off the accommodation.

Rvtd bus stop is at a distance of merely a 5-minute walk from Mccall House Boutique Hotel.

Rooms

The rooms include a stone fireplace, along with a sofa and a writing table for guests' comfort. Also, there are tea and coffee making facilities as well as smoke detectors provided.

Eat & Drink

Tot Restaurant is merely 7 minutes' walk away.
